Since leg uses this as a math vent chat
I spent so much time trying this from so many different angles, but the actual solution is so trivial I feel mad I did not ralize it
Intuatively, the limit should be about 3/2, since that is the expected value of each Xi, actual answer is 4/e (I was just assuming it was 3/2's which was tripping me up). I literally just needed use the strong law of large numbers on the natural log of that
What really kills me about this, is I kept second guessing myself, so I coded up a quick program to check that it did converge to 3/2's, and kept getting 1.47ish, which is 4/e, not 3/2!
